Subject: Franchise Agreement — Harrowfield Territory

Executive team,

The franchise agreement with Bramwell Trading for the Harrowfield territory is signed. Branch managers: royalty terms are 6% on gross, quarterly remittance, five-year term with one renewal option. Bramwell handles local staffing; we retain brand and supply control. Training starts next month at the Kestrel Point site. Keep terms internal until the joint announcement. The strategic reasoning behind this deal is noted below for your eyes only.

board note of tadup-tajog: Headcount on the Oliiel team goes from 31 to 88 by the end of February. Gross margin on Oliiel came in at 62 percent against a plan of 29 percent.

# Alert deduplication for the Nightowl on-call pipeline.
#
# Incoming alerts are fingerprinted on source, check name, and a
# normalized message; duplicates within the suppression window are
# merged into the open incident rather than re-paging. Flapping
# signals get an extended window. Changing any of these values
# alters paging volume immediately, so coordinate with the on-call
# rotation first. The tuning constants follow below.

tuning table, yajog-yahof:
BUDGETS = {
    "lamvan": 303,
    "wenox": 460,
    "fenvan": 525,
}

Hi Marisol — handing over coverage of the spare-hardware store on Level 2 while I'm away. It holds replacement keyboards, monitors, and docking cables for the Brellix floor teams. Please log every item taken in the blue ledger on the shelf by the door, including date and requester's name. The room should stay locked at all times; check the latch clicks shut. The keypad accepts the code below.

badge for fahop-fawip: bdg-EZRSJ-25213